30 May 2026
Technology is advancing at lightning speed, and the way we educate our children needs to keep up. Coding is no longer just for computer geeks or Silicon Valley entrepreneurs—it’s a fundamental skill that should be taught to every student, just like math and science.
But why is coding so important? And why should it be a core subject in every school curriculum? Let’s dive in and explore why programming is a game-changer for students and their future! 
If schools aim to prepare students for the real world, then coding must be part of the curriculum. It’s not just about learning how to program but understanding how the digital world works. Kids who can code are not just consumers of technology—they become creators and innovators.
When students write code, they learn to think logically, troubleshoot errors, and develop solutions. This logical thinking extends beyond the computer screen and helps them tackle real-life problems with confidence.
Imagine your child struggling with a math problem. With coding experience, they’re more likely to approach it with patience and a structured mindset rather than feeling overwhelmed. That’s a game-changer! 
Students get to build their own apps, design games, and even create animations. It’s like giving them a virtual canvas where the only limitation is their imagination. When kids see their creative ideas come to life through code, it fuels their passion and confidence to explore new possibilities.
Plus, creativity isn’t just for artists—it's essential in science, engineering, business, and beyond. Coding nurtures a mindset that embraces experimentation, which is a crucial trait in any field.
According to reports, careers in software development, cybersecurity, artificial intelligence, and data science are among the fastest-growing. Even if a student doesn’t plan to become a programmer, coding knowledge gives them a competitive edge in many professions, from medicine to finance and even law.
Think about it—wouldn’t you want your child to graduate with a skill set that makes them highly employable? Schools should equip students with skills that will help them thrive in the future job market, and coding is undeniably one of them.
Learning to code strengthens mathematical concepts like algebra, logic, and reasoning. When kids see how math applies to real-world technology—like gaming algorithms or financial apps—it makes learning more exciting.
It’s like a secret weapon for making math less intimidating and more interactive. Instead of just solving equations on paper, students get to use math in a hands-on way, which leads to better understanding and retention.
Coding teaches kids that failure isn’t the end; it’s just part of the process. They learn to embrace mistakes, analyze what went wrong, and keep trying until they succeed. This builds resilience, patience, and a growth mindset—qualities that are essential for success in any field.
In a world where instant gratification is the norm, coding teaches kids the value of persistence and hard work. And that’s an invaluable life lesson.
When students work on coding assignments, they often collaborate, share ideas, and learn how to explain their thought processes. This strengthens their communication skills, which are crucial in any profession.
Even in industries outside of tech, being able to discuss ideas clearly, work in teams, and solve problems collaboratively is a huge advantage. Coding naturally cultivates these skills in a fun and engaging way.
Many coding platforms like Scratch, Python, and Roblox allow students to turn their lessons into interactive projects or video games. Learning becomes exciting because students see immediate results from their work.
Wouldn’t it be amazing if lessons felt like a game rather than a chore? By integrating coding into the curriculum, schools can make learning more dynamic and enjoyable.
By teaching coding in schools, we create a more level playing field, allowing students from all walks of life to thrive in the digital age. It’s about giving every child a fair shot at success.
The earlier students start learning, the better equipped they will be to adapt to a world that revolves around technology. Schools should treat coding just like reading and writing because, in the digital age, it's just as important.
So, should coding be a core subject in every school curriculum? Absolutely! It’s time to embrace the future and equip the next generation with the skills they truly need. Let’s make coding as natural as learning ABCs and 123s—because, in the modern world, it’s just as essential.
all images in this post were generated using AI tools
Category:
Coding In SchoolsAuthor:
Charlotte Rogers